    2, IRETON ROAD, LEICESTER, LEICESTER, LE4 9ER

    This semi-detached freehold property on Ireton Road last sold in April 2006 for £99,000. Based on price growth in the LE4 district since then, its estimated current value is £205,067 — placing it in the 26th percentile nationally and the 20th percentile within LE4. The property covers 32 m² (344 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£6,408 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.
